How they compare
Panama currently reports 18.0% against 17.7% in Serbia, a difference of 0.3%.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Serbia has been ahead every year.
Panama ranks 43rd and Serbia ranks 45th of 79 countries.

About this data
Share of all employed people who are paid employees of the public sector, including government, the armed forces, public services, and state-owned enterprises.
